Output 5896b592cab3f21868d077052d1baf99b1d21c0ae82f1f603b8ea634ab3681de:0

value
1689
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 06b758c9607d3680d49f17ccc28132428083a49511218f77cc856f3c2ee46486
address
bc1pq6m43jtq05mgp4ylzlxv9qfjg2qg8fy4zysc7a7vs4hncthyvjrqlq5hpt
transaction
5896b592cab3f21868d077052d1baf99b1d21c0ae82f1f603b8ea634ab3681de
spent
true